Maintaining optimal ventilation is crucial for ensuring a healthy and comfortable indoor environment. Effective ventilation methods promote air circulation, reducing the buildup of stale air, pollutants, and moisture. Using proper ventilation techniques, you can improve air quality, reduce the spread of airborne pathogens, and foster a more pleasant living or working space.

  • Evaluate factors like room size, occupancy, and ventilation requirements when determining appropriate ventilation methods.
  • Incorporate a combination of natural and mechanical ventilation options.
  • Continuously maintain your ventilation units to ensure optimal performance.

Superior Air Circulation: The Power of Ventilation Systems

Ventilation units are the backbone of any structure that prioritizes air quality. They work by moving air, removing stale or contaminated air and introducing fresh air. This constant exchange of air has significant benefits for both the environment itself and its occupants.

A well-designed ventilation setup can boost indoor conditions, reducing the risk of sickness caused by poor air quality. It also helps to control temperature and moisture, creating a more pleasant space.

Furthermore, ventilation units can play a crucial role in avoiding the build-up of mold, which can be a major health hazard.

By optimizing airflow, ventilation networks not only enhance the overall well-being of occupants but also safeguard the structure of the building itself.
